Key ceremony — Tarnmill tax-rate lookup cache. Steps: confirm two custodians present; verify cache snapshot checksum; rotate the signing key in Oakhenge HSM; flush stale rate entries; re-warm cache from the Velder feed. Record timestamps in the ceremony log. Future maintainers: the rotation console will prompt once, and it accepts only the recovery passphrase noted below.

strongbox words: zordor-quenax

## Step 7: Repoint the partner SFTP drop

Before the release window closes, redirect the Calverro partner drop to the new ingest host. Verify the chroot directory exists, that the landing path matches what Norridge Analytics expects, and that the pickup daemon is stopped on the old host to prevent double-processing. Once verified, restart the pickup daemon on the new host using the configuration values below.

settings of tahag-tahag:
[istdor]
host = istdor.tolvaqcorp.corp
user = istdor_svc
database = istdor_prod

Weekly Eng Sync — Notes

DeployBot update: the chat bot now posts deploy status to the #releases channel automatically. Rollback notifications are still manual; we agreed to add those next sprint. Staging alerts were noisy last week, so thresholds were tuned down. Remaining work: edge-case handling for canceled pipelines and a help command. Ownership of the DeployBot workstream goes to:

signatory, kaweg-fawig: Zorys Druys Jorius Novael